Doug comes home with a bandage on his finger. The story behind it was not a fun one.
Seems he was cleaning up some instruments after a surgery. This is part of his job...to go into the OR and get the gunky nasty instruments after they are used for surgery and clean and sanitize them.
He is gowned, masked, gloved...the whole thing. Always.
A sharp, bloody instrument snags his glove, rips it and cuts his finger.
He is carted off to the ER. The wound is cleaned and bandaged and he and the patient, who just had surgery, are immedately tested for HIV and the hepititises. He, being a health care worker, is of course vaccinated for everything he can be, but there is no vaccine for some of the heps and the HIV.
What now? The HIV test came back when he was ready to go home. Negative. THANK GOD! He will be re-tested in a few weeks, but they say there is really no risk. The rest of the tests should be back tomorrow.
Chances are slim anything was contracted, even if she had anything, but it's still scary. Keep us in your prayers!
